10-(6-Hydroxyhexa-2,4-diyn-1-yl)-10H-phenothiazine 5-oxide

description | The title compound, C(18)H(13)NO(2)S, has two independent molecules (A and B) with similar conformations in the asymmetric unit. Both phenothiazine moieties have a butterfly structure [dihedral angles between benzene rings = 155.17 (7) and 161.71 (7)°, respectively], and the central six-membered rings have a boat form. In the crystal, the A and B molecules stack alternately along the b axis. The A and B molecules are linked by O—H⋯O=S hydrogen bonds, forming zigzag chains along [10-1]. |
